Adventures of Link: Alaska Airlines Wants In-Flight WiFi, Too

9/19/2007 at 5:05 PM
Tags: , , , , (all tags)

Alaska Airlines wasn't content to watch Virgin America and American Airlines race to see who would be the first to offer in-flight WiFi. So they've jumped into the game with a plan to offer satellite 'net access on at least one flight by next spring. And Alaska is going a different way, choosing the Row 44 to develop its system, rather than market powerhouse AirCell.

JetBlue, don't forget, is also trying to develop an in-flight system, but has been quiet about progress--or lack of progress--as of late. American wants to get its system working on 767s first, then consider a fleet-wide deployment. And remember, Virgin America says it will equip all its jets by 2008.
